1. Age RequirementsThe minimum age to rent a car in Neumünster is typically 21, but some companies may have higher age limits or charge young driver fees for those under 25.
2. Driver’s Licence & DocumentationA valid driver’s licence is required. If your licence is not in German, an International Driving Permit (IDP) may be necessary.
3. Insurance & DepositsRental agreements usually include basic insurance, but you can opt for additional coverage like Collision Damage Waiver (CDW). A security deposit is typically required and held on your credit card.
4. Mileage & Fuel PolicyCheck the mileage policy, as some rentals have mileage limits. Fuel policies vary, with most requiring you to return the car with a full tank.
5. Additional FeesAdditional fees may apply for extra drivers, one-way rentals, GPS navigation, or child seats.

Neumünster is a mid-sized city in Schleswig-Holstein, Germany, known for its industrial history and convenient location for exploring the region.
Driving in Neumünster is generally straightforward, but be aware of local traffic regulations and speed limits.
Top Attractions to Discover
Gerisch Sculpture Park
A unique outdoor museum featuring contemporary sculptures in a beautiful setting.
Tuch + Technik Textile Museum
Explore the history of textile production in Neumünster.
Caspar von Saldern House
A historic building with a beautiful baroque facade.

Railway Stations
Neumünster Main Station
The main railway station connects Neumünster to major cities in Germany and beyond.
Bus Stations
Central Bus Station
Located near the main train station, the central bus station provides regional bus services.
Airports
Hamburg Airport (HAM)
The nearest major airport is Hamburg Airport, located approximately 65 kilometres (40 miles) from Neumünster.
